Biography contributed by Katherine Blakeley.

Annie Pickett was born about 1860 in Ireland - she emigrated to New Zealand in the mid 1870’s.

Annie married printer Thomas Lawson in Palmerston, north of Dunedin, on 25 November 1878.

They had five sons and lived in Palmerston and Timaru before moving to Dunedin.

When Annie signed the suffrage petition the family were living in Forth Street.

Thomas died in 1906 – he was buried in the Northern Cemtery.

Annie died at her son’s home in Burnside on 8 August 1938 – she was cremated and her ashes were scattered.
